Abstract
The utility model relates to the technical field of polishing equipment and discloses a polishing device for production of a fixture, which comprises a base, wherein the upper end of the base is provided with a shell, the interior of the shell is fixedly connected with a bidirectional threaded rod, the upper end and the lower end of the bidirectional threaded rod are respectively in threaded connection with a moving block, two moving blocks are respectively arranged at the front ends of the two moving blocks, the front ends and the rear ends of the shell are respectively fixedly connected with a pushing mechanism, the rear side of the upper end of the base is fixedly connected with a fixing plate, and the left end and the right end of the fixing plate are fixedly provided with polishing mechanisms. Technical Field
The utility model relates to the technical field of polishing equipment, in particular to a polishing device for production of a fixture.
Background
The fixture is a general name of various tools used in the manufacturing process, and comprises a cutter, a clamp, a die, a measuring tool, a checking tool, an auxiliary tool and other clamps, when the fixture is produced, polishing operation is required to be carried out on the fixture body, the compactness and smoothness of the surface of the fixture are guaranteed to reach the qualification rate, and then a special polishing device is required to be used for carrying out auxiliary operation, so that the process is conveniently and rapidly completed.

Working principle: firstly, a part is placed into a concave groove 503, a rotation motor 301 rotates to drive a bidirectional threaded rod 3 to rotate, so that two moving blocks 4 move to the middle, the two concave grooves 503 clamp the part, a rotation motor 805 pushed by a telescopic cylinder enables a polishing sheet 801 to be close to the polishing sheet 801 for polishing the part, a rotation motor 805 rotates to drive a connecting plate 803 to rotate, the two polishing sheets 801 rotate to achieve deep polishing, and an electric telescopic rod II 601 drives a push plate 602 to push the part out after polishing is finished.
